What do we do, you ask
We accept staple food items year round, run food drives at holidays and
as needed. These items are delivered with supplemental grocery certificates
at holidays and monthly, if needed. Members prepare and serve a monthly
luncheon at the West Side Catholic Center. We visit parish shut-ins and
nursing home residents twice per year. The Christmas Angel program begins
in Advent each year. We hold an annual rummage sale to raise money for gift
cards, food to supplement the donations that we receive, and for miscellaneous
expenses. We collect paper supplies annually for the West Side Catholic Center.
